* @copyright 2015-2024 Nicola Asuni - Tecnick.com LTD * @license http://www.gnu.org/copyleft/lesser.html GNU-LGPL v3 (see LICENSE.TXT) * @link https://github.com/tecnickcom/tc-lib-pdf * * This file is part of tc-lib-file software library. */ namespace Test; use PHPUnit\Framework\TestCase; /** * Test Util * * @since 2020-12-19 * @category Library * @package Pdf * @author Nicola Asuni * @copyright 2015-2024 Nicola Asuni - Tecnick.com LTD * @license http://www.gnu.org/copyleft/lesser.html GNU-LGPL v3 (see LICENSE.TXT) * @link https://github.com/tecnickcom/tc-lib-pdf */ class TestUtil extends TestCase { public function bcAssertEqualsWithDelta( mixed $expected, mixed $actual, float $delta = 0.01, string $message = '' ): void { parent::assertEqualsWithDelta($expected, $actual, $delta, $message); } /** * @param class-string<\Throwable> $exception */ public function bcExpectException($exception): void { parent::expectException($exception); } public function bcAssertIsResource(mixed $res): void { parent::assertIsResource($res); } public function bcAssertMatchesRegularExpression(string $pattern, string $string, string $message = ''): void { parent::assertMatchesRegularExpression($pattern, $string, $message); } }